Salary Guide for Teachers in Dayton

📊 Salaries for teachers in Dayton align with WA public scales: Graduates (Level 1) $78,513–$85,000; Proficient (2.1-2.4) $95,000–$110,000; Highly Accomplished $115,000+. Private schools add 5-10%. Factors: Experience, allowances ($5k+ rural), super 11%. Below national avg $100k due to metro adjustment, but COL 15% lower. Benefits: 20 days leave, PD funding.

Weather and Climate in Dayton

☀️ Dayton's Mediterranean climate features hot, dry summers (Dec-Feb: 31°C/18°C highs, minimal rain) ideal for outdoor sports, and mild, wet winters (Jun-Aug: 18°C/9°C, 150mm rain/month) suiting indoor projects. Annual avg 22°C, 870mm rain, 8 sunshine hrs/day. Impacts: Summer hydration protocols, winter flood prep; enhances lifestyle with beach trips (40min drive).
